Composition

In the context of fashion magazine layout, composition plays a vital role in creating visually appealing and impactful pages. It involves the arrangement of various elements such as text, images, and white space to achieve a harmonious and balanced design.

  • Focal Point: A magazine layout often features a focal point, which is an element that immediately draws the reader’s attention. This can be a striking image, a bold headline, or a visually distinct quote. The placement and size of the focal point influence how the reader navigates the rest of the page.
  • Balance: Visual balance is crucial in creating a pleasing layout. Elements can be balanced symmetrically, with equal weight on both sides of the page, or asymmetrically, creating a more dynamic and visually interesting design.
  • Hierarchy: Composition helps establish a visual hierarchy, guiding the reader’s eye through the most important elements. Larger fonts, contrasting colors, and strategic placement can emphasize key information and create a logical flow of content.
  • White Space: Effective use of white space enhances readability, prevents clutter, and draws attention to specific elements. It creates a sense of sophistication and allows the magazine’s content to breathe.

Overall, composition is an essential aspect of fashion magazine layout, influencing the reader’s engagement, comprehension, and overall experience with the publication.

Typography

Typography plays a crucial role in fashion magazine layout, enhancing the readability, conveying the desired tone, and reinforcing the magazine’s brand identity.

  • Legibility: Fashion magazines often use a variety of typefaces, but legibility remains a top priority. Fonts are carefully chosen to ensure that text is easy to read, even in small sizes or on different types of paper.
  • Hierarchy: Typography helps establish a clear hierarchy of information. Headlines, subheads, and body text are typically set in different fonts, sizes, and weights to create a visual hierarchy that guides the reader’s eye through the content.
  • Tone: The choice of typeface can convey a specific tone or mood. For example, serif fonts are often perceived as more traditional and elegant, while sans-serif fonts are seen as more modern and minimalist.
  • Brand Identity: Typography contributes to the magazine’s overall brand identity. Fashion magazines often develop signature fonts or typographic styles that become synonymous with their brand, reinforcing their unique identity in the market.

Overall, typography is an integral part of fashion magazine layout, influencing the reader’s experience, conveying the magazine’s tone, and contributing to its overall brand identity.

Color

Color is a powerful tool in fashion magazine layout, capable of evoking emotions, creating contrast, and guiding the reader’s eye through the content. Fashion magazines use color strategically to enhance the visual appeal of their pages and convey specific messages to their readers.


Emotional Impact: Colors have the ability to evoke strong emotions in humans. Fashion magazines leverage this psychological effect by using colors to create the desired atmosphere or mood. For example, warm colors like red and orange can stimulate excitement and passion, while cool colors like blue and green can evoke a sense of calm and tranquility.


Contrast and Emphasis: Color contrast is a fundamental design principle that helps draw attention to specific elements on the page. Fashion magazines use contrasting colors to highlight important headlines, showcase key fashion pieces, or create a focal point that guides the reader’s eye through the layout.


Visual Hierarchy: Color can also be used to establish a visual hierarchy, organizing and prioritizing information on the page. By using different colors for different sections or elements, fashion magazines can guide the reader’s eye towards the most important content and create a logical flow of information.


Brand Identity: Color plays a significant role in shaping a fashion magazine’s brand identity. Many magazines use signature color schemes or specific color combinations that become synonymous with their brand and differentiate them from competitors.

Understanding the connection between color and fashion magazine layout is essential for creating visually appealing and impactful publications. By harnessing the power of color, fashion magazines can evoke emotions, create contrast, guide the reader’s eye, and reinforce their brand identity.

Illustration

In the realm of fashion magazine layout, illustration plays a significant role as a complementary or alternative medium to photography. Fashion illustrators use their artistic skills to create visually captivating and imaginative representations of fashion trends, products, and concepts.

Illustrations offer several advantages within the context of fashion magazine layout. Firstly, they provide a unique and artistic interpretation of fashion, allowing magazines to showcase a broader range of styles and perspectives. Unlike photography, illustration is not bound by the constraints of capturing reality, giving artists the freedom to explore exaggerated proportions, vibrant colors, and whimsical concepts.

Secondly, illustrations can be used to complement or enhance photographic content. They can add a touch of fantasy or surrealism to fashion spreads, creating a more visually engaging and memorable experience for readers. For example, fashion magazines often commission illustrators to create whimsical interpretations of haute couture gowns or depict models in dreamlike, fashion-forward settings.

Moreover, illustrations can be particularly effective in conveying specific moods, emotions, or themes that may be difficult to capture through photography alone. For instance, an illustration might be used to evoke a sense of nostalgia, glamour, or rebellion, reinforcing the overall message or tone of a fashion editorial.

The practical significance of understanding the connection between illustration and fashion magazine layout lies in its ability to expand the creative possibilities and storytelling capabilities of fashion publications. By incorporating illustrations, fashion magazines can cater to a wider range of audiences, appeal to different tastes and sensibilities, and create a more diverse and visually stimulating reading experience.

Whitespace

Whitespace, often referred to as negative space, is a crucial element in fashion magazine layout. It plays a vital role in enhancing the visual appeal, readability, and overall impact of the publication.

  • Creating Visual Interest: Whitespace provides a visual break between elements, allowing them to stand out and creating a sense of visual hierarchy. By intentionally placing whitespace around images, headlines, and text blocks, designers can draw the reader’s eye to specific areas and create a more dynamic and engaging layout.
  • Emphasizing Elements: Whitespace can be used to emphasize important elements on the page. By surrounding a particular image, headline, or quote with ample whitespace, designers can isolate it from the rest of the content, making it the focal point and drawing the reader’s attention to its significance.
  • Improving Readability: Whitespace enhances readability by reducing visual clutter and improving the flow of text. When there is sufficient whitespace between lines of text and around paragraphs, readers can more easily follow the text and comprehend the content. This is especially important in fashion magazines, where there is often a significant amount of text accompanying the visuals.
  • Guiding the Reader’s Eye: Whitespace can be used to guide the reader’s eye through the layout. By strategically placing whitespace around different elements, designers can create a visual hierarchy that leads the reader’s gaze from one element to the next, ensuring a smooth and intuitive reading experience.

Understanding the importance of whitespace in fashion magazine layout is essential for creating visually appealing and effective publications. By harnessing the power of negative space, designers can enhance the impact of images, improve readability, and guide the reader’s journey through the content, ultimately elevating the overall experience of the fashion magazine.

Flow

In the context of fashion magazine layout, flow refers to the seamless transition between elements, guiding the reader’s eye effortlessly through the content. It is a crucial aspect of creating a cohesive and visually appealing publication that enhances the reader’s experience and comprehension.

  • Visual Hierarchy: Flow is closely tied to visual hierarchy, ensuring that the most important elements stand out, while secondary elements recede into the background. By manipulating font sizes, weights, colors, and placement, designers create a visual hierarchy that guides the reader’s eye through the layout, emphasizing key information and establishing a logical reading order.
  • Whitespace and Proximity: Whitespace and proximity play a vital role in creating flow. Strategic use of whitespace around elements provides visual breathing room, allowing the content to breathe and preventing a cluttered appearance. Proximity, on the other hand, refers to the intentional placement of related elements close together, creating visual connections and guiding the reader’s eye from one element to the next.
  • Page Architecture: The overall architecture of the page contributes to flow. Designers carefully plan the placement of headlines, images, and text blocks to create a harmonious and visually appealing layout. Grid systems and modular design approaches are often employed to ensure consistency and balance throughout the magazine.
  • Typographic Elements: Typographic elements, such as font choice, size, and leading, can enhance flow and guide the reader’s eye. By using contrasting fonts for headlines and body text, designers create visual interest and differentiation. Leading, the space between lines of text, affects readability and ensures smooth transitions between paragraphs.

Understanding the connection between flow and fashion magazine layout is essential for creating visually appealing and effective publications. By implementing these principles, designers can enhance the reader’s experience, improve comprehension, and ultimately convey the intended message of the magazine.
